## Formula sandbox tuning

User-supplied formulas in Gridmoor execute inside a restricted interpreter with hard ceilings on time, memory, and call depth. Reviewers should confirm any change to these ceilings is justified in the PR description, since raising them widens the abuse surface. Defaults were chosen from production traces. The current limits are as follows.

limits module of tafog-fawip:
WEIGHTS = {
    "julix": 57,
    "lamys": 992,
    "kasvan": 209,
    "quenok": 750,
    "alddor": 259,
    "oliath": 1009,
    "wenix": 815,
}

Welcome to on-call for SnackRoute, Kelber Vending's restock planner. Shifts rotate weekly. The planner pulls inventory telemetry every 15 minutes; if sync stalls, restart the poller before escalating. Dashboards live in the Grids workspace under SnackRoute-Ops. Deploys go through the Fenwick pipeline only — no manual pushes. Runbooks cover the top five alerts; read them before your first shift. To run the poller locally, copy env.sample to .env and add the telemetry token on the next line.

vault entry, yahaf-tagug: LEDGER_TOKEN20=884d77d1a8b98aa4edfb

Subject: Partner SFTP drop — new owner

Hi,

As you review the pending changes to the Harborline ingest scripts, note that ownership of the partner SFTP drop is changing at the end of the month. This includes key rotation, the nightly pull job, and the quarantine folder for malformed files. Review comments on the retry logic should still go through the normal PR flow, but questions about drop-folder conventions or partner onboarding now go to the new owner. The incoming owner is listed below.

signatory, tagaf-bahaf: Praael Fenmir Rusok

Subject: Gateway cut-over done — new rate limits live

Hey plugin folks,

The Brimble gateway cut-over wrapped up last night without drama. Rate limiting now runs on the new token-bucket tier, so bursty plugins will see smoother throttling instead of hard 429 walls. Please retest anything that polls aggressively. For reference, here are the limits now in effect:

service settings:
PRAIX_LOG_LEVEL=error
PRAIX_METRICS_HOST=metrics.praix.qorvelcorp.corp
PRAIX_POOL_SIZE=16